Cross-Space Adaptive Filter: Integrating Graph Topology and Node Attributes for Alleviating the Over-smoothing Problem

Contact: Chen Huang

A cross-space filter is proposed to produce the adaptive-frequency information extracted from both the topology and attribute spaces. It alleviates the over-smoothing problem while simultaneously promoting the effectiveness of downstream tasks.
